89 evinrude no high speed
 
I have a 89 40 hp evinrude, that won't run at high speed. It been that
way whenwe started it up this year. It was fogged for the winter. I
have rebuilt the carbs, new fuel filter, plugs. Tried new gas. It start
up fine. When you start it up cold, we'll pull up the handle to give it
more air. And it use to scream. Now it just run realy ruff. I been told
it was the carbs. They were very clean inside, replaced the guts. Blow
out all the holes.
Not sure what to check now!

Sounds like a fuel starvation problem. Make sure the primer bulb is not
colapsing and make sure the fuel tank pickup is clean.
It could be the fuel pump also but that would be my last thing to change.
When it stumbles - try engaging the choke and see if that helps. If it
does - then you definetly have a carb problem.
Try tearing down the carbs again and make sure the float is set properly and
the jets are clean.
If it does nothing when you engage the choke (no change) then you have a
fuel starvation problem somewhere in the fuel system/pump.
